Growler fill from the Green Growler Grocery in Croton on Hudson NY
Pours near black, dark mocha cap, and leaving respectable looking fine sheeting.
Heavy coffee on the nose
Enjoyable and robust porter, waves of chocolate and more coffee on the palate. Smooth and velvety on the tongue....all the beers I've had from IA have been awesome...this one is no different.....looking forward to when they start canning

On tap at Tap and Mallet in Rochester, NY.
This one pours a very dark brown, with a small head, and a little bit of lacing.
Smells like heavily roasted, basically charred malt, fruity coffee, raisin, and dark chocolate.
This is really, really solid. There's a lot of coffee here, but it doesn't overwhelm the wonderfully roasty base. There's some nice dark fruit, and tons of chocolate, as well.
This is medium bodied, pretty creamy, with a good level of carbonation.
It's nice to see that this brewery can do other styles, other than hoppy stuff.
